平常工作中,如果没有封装好的框架,获取url中的请求参数是很麻烦的一件事。下列代码,解决了“将对象的值拼接到Url”和“从Url获取参数转换为对象”两个问题。 ...
HttpClient .X发送Get请求的参数拼接 使用httpClient发送get请求时,请求参数可以以 key val amp key val 的拼接到url后面。 但是请求参数较多时,这种方法比较麻烦,也不太优雅 研究了一下发现HttpClient .X本身 是支持处理参数的。 . 使用 URIBuilder来构建请求URI httpclient相关的jar包mvn依赖: . 使用 Nam ...
2017-11-22 16:07 0 10777 推荐指数:
平常工作中,如果没有封装好的框架,获取url中的请求参数是很麻烦的一件事。下列代码,解决了“将对象的值拼接到Url”和“从Url获取参数转换为对象”两个问题。 ...
使用到Spring提供的工具类UriComponentsBuilder 代码: 效果: 注意queryParam(String name, Object... values) 第二个参数是变长参数,不能传null,但可以传值为null的变量。 ...
org.apache.commons.httpclient.DefaultHttpMethodRetryHandler; import org.apache.commons.httpclient.Heade ...
前端get请求url拼接多项参数方法 ...
参考博客:https://www.cnblogs.com/LuckyBao/p/6096145.html 1.需要的maven依赖: 2.发送get请求 3.httpClient发送post请求(携带json数据) 4.httpClient发送 ...
post请求方法和get请求方法 ...
现象如图:传递了2个id参数却只有一个参数拼接到了url后面 产生原因:字典的值不可重复,导致同名参数会被覆盖。 解决:使用get请求的另外一种传值方式传array数组,也就是用python里面的list传值。参考上海悠悠博客:https://www.cnblogs.com ...